Chile's Pokémon Kanto Medal Shortage Fuels Collector Frenzy

Original gym medals from the first‑generation Kanto region of the Pokémon franchise have become extremely scarce in Chile, with both digital and physical retailers reporting near‑zero stock. Collectors describe the medals as a “holy grail” of the hobby.

A Mercado Libre study shows that sales of Pokémon collectible cards have quintupled in Chile over the past two years, reflecting heightened demand. Veteran collectors Nelson Peña Escalera and former card‑champion Juan Torres Escalera say the medals’ emotional and monetary value continue to rise, and no plans exist to produce official replicas, keeping the original items uniquely prized.
